Transaction 412eb105de93ea0f14feff07889b20808a5a4ae34335711aba2ff56abb438457
2 Input
2 Outputs
- 412eb105de93ea0f14feff07889b20808a5a4ae34335711aba2ff56abb438457:0
- 412eb105de93ea0f14feff07889b20808a5a4ae34335711aba2ff56abb438457:1
value 658404
address 34FiRBbuLXmXwYsUgXD6UWY8k8zwQ7g52A
value 3353
address 14fxkZgCRwoANeDvTgCQUJB2pnyuKZG7nW